The Importance of Safe Sleeping

The first year of life is crucial for a baby's development, and sleep plays an essential role in this procedure. The American Academy of Pediatrics (AAP) suggests the following guidelines to guarantee safe sleep for infants:

  1. Place the baby on their back to sleep.
  2. Use a company and flat sleep surface.
  3. Keep the sleep location devoid of soft bed linen, including blankets, pillows, and packed animals.
  4. Guarantee a smoke-free environment.
  5. Breastfeeding is motivated as it is connected with reduced SIDS danger.

How Parents Can Choose Safe Sleep Solutions

When choosing a safe sleeping environment for a baby, parents can follow a structured method to guarantee they make informed decisions. Here are some crucial factors to consider:

  1. Compliance with Safety Standards: Always validate that cribs, bassinets, and play lawns fulfill current security guidelines.
  2. Type of Crib: Consider utilizing baby cribs that have adjustable mattress heights and strong building and construction to ensure long-lasting security.
  3. Age Appropriateness: Choose a sleeping solution that is suitable for the baby's age and weight.
  4. Evaluate Used Items: If selecting pre-owned cribs, check for recalls and make sure the baby crib is in great condition without missing out on parts.
  5. Educate Yourself: Make use of resources supplied by organizations like Cots 4 Tots to understand safe sleep practices.

List: Questions to Ask When Choosing a Sleeping Arrangement

  • Is this baby crib or bassinet certified with the current safety requirements?
  • Does the bed mattress fit snugly in the crib with no spaces?
  • Are there any loose or missing hardware parts?
  • Is the crib devoid of any soft bedding, toys, or pillows?
  • Have I been informed about the safe sleep standards by a relied on source?

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

What age should I transition my baby to a baby crib?

Many infants can transition to a baby crib around 3 months of age or when they outgrow their bassinet. Constantly consult your pediatrician for customized recommendations.

Are pre-owned cribs safe?

Second-hand baby cribs can be safe if they abide by existing safety standards. Look for recalls and guarantee all parts are undamaged before use.

How can I decrease the danger of SIDS for my baby?

To reduce SIDS risk, always put your baby on their back to sleep, utilize a firm mattress, avoid soft bed linen, and practice safe sleep strategies.

What should I do if I can not afford a crib?

Reach out to regional companies like Cots 4 Tots, which might offer resources and assistance for families in need.

Can I use sleep positioners for my baby?

The AAP encourages versus making use of sleep positioners as they present threats of suffocation. Always place infants on their backs with no gadgets.
